Special tools for retaining bolt key-washer removal are not available, it cause retaining bolt key-washer cannot be removed at PT6A-20A engine practical, so that need to design these special tools. First step to design retaining bolt key-washer detachment tool as gas generator turbine disk aiding detacher tool for motor turbine PT6A-20A is to define weight, dimension, and force in which the tool is used. Then followed by the calculation and measuring process so that the shape, dimension and material for this tool can be determined. Next the writer start to design based on the available calculation and measurements by using theories related to this particular design. Then followed by the manufacturing of the tool based on the design being made.The tool is manufactured with 24,6 mm of detachment tool diameter and have 7,2 mm of high and 2,2 mm of thick. Protector tool have 38 mm outside diameter and 26 inner diameter. From the result of testing process,the retaining bolt keywasher dettachment tool has successfully removed the retaining bolt keywasher with the moment 78.056,60 N-mm and the protector toll has succesfully to protect hole of gas generator turbine disk shaft with moment 23.416,05 N-mm. And is set to use on cadet’s practice to fulfill motor turbine syllabus due to the unavailability of protective tool on the axle of gas generator turbine disk and retaining bolt key-washer detachment tool on gas generator turbine disk on motor turbine PT6A-20A in Hangar 01 Aircraft Engineering
